Transaction b10e86225a24a51cdfda8ef95628353a41f9a90047b0e6d58ca93f897955dd97
1 Input
1 Output
-
b10e86225a24a51cdfda8ef95628353a41f9a90047b0e6d58ca93f897955dd97:0
- value
- 17878619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d4efb216fd9da49843263051ff81aadc1c35758 OP_EQUAL
- address
- 3JwzFVdAkH1h51RPbX7ny3ad4agQAmMtSK